</div>]]></content><author><name></name></author><summary type="html"><![CDATA[Katelyn, Alex, Zexuan, and Adam represented the DIG lab in Minneapolis.]]></summary></entry><entry><title type="html">Workshop: Tactile Graphics Tech and Media</title><link href="https://dig.cmu.edu/2022/10/31/tactile-workshop.html" rel="alternate" type="text/html" title="Workshop: Tactile Graphics Tech and Media" /><published>2022-10-31T00:00:00+00:00</published><updated>2022-10-31T00:00:00+00:00</updated><id>https://dig.cmu.edu/2022/10/31/tactile-workshop</id><content type="html" xml:base="https://dig.cmu.edu/2022/10/31/tactile-workshop.html"><![CDATA[<p>We will be having Chancey Fleet visit to help us host a workshop on braille and tactile graphics here at CMU. Chancey is a resident scholar at <a href="https://datasociety.net/people/fleet-chancey/">Data and Society</a> and Assistive Technology Coordinator at the New York Public Library, including lead of their Dimensions Lab project. Chancey is a blind researcher and practitioner who has a wide array of unique expertise in tactile and braille media, data ethics, and data work.</p>

<p>While our lab is specifically interested in accessible data representation authoring and accessible analytical work, we want to focus this workshop on the connections we hope to form with our community related to graphics (as a broader topic) and braille and tactile media and set the groundwork for better understanding the materials and tools we have available to us.</p>

<p><strong>Background:</strong> Many machine learning models work by generating a “latent space” which maps out (or “embeds”) the input data to better perform a downstream task, such as classification. Visualizing these embedding spaces is an important step to make sure that the model has learned the desired attributes (e.g. correctly separating dogs from cats, or cancer cells from non-cancer cells). However, most existing visualizations are static and are quite difficult to compare from one model to another. We have designed a system, called Emblaze, that allows experts to visualize these embedding spaces within a Jupyter notebook, and visually compare and inspect across multiple spaces. <a href="https://github.com/cmudig/emblaze" target="_blank">Emblaze is publicly available on GitHub</a>.
